Linux下PHP环境搭建与高效数据库配置指南
|
2026建议图AI生成,仅供参考 在Linux系统上搭建PHP环境是开发和部署Web应用的基础步骤。常见的发行版如Ubuntu、CentOS等都提供了丰富的软件包管理工具,能够简化安装过程。选择合适的Linux发行版后,首先需要更新系统软件包,确保所有组件都是最新的。安装PHP通常可以通过包管理器完成,例如在Ubuntu中使用apt-get,或在CentOS中使用yum。根据需求选择PHP版本,同时安装必要的扩展,如mysql、curl、json等,以支持不同的功能模块。 除了PHP本身,Web服务器的配置同样重要。Apache或Nginx是常用的Web服务器,它们可以与PHP配合工作。配置文件的调整,如设置默认文档、处理PHP脚本的解析方式,直接影响到网站的运行效率。 数据库配置是提升性能的关键环节。MySQL或MariaDB是最常见的选择,正确设置数据库连接参数、字符集和缓存机制可以显著优化查询速度。定期备份和监控数据库状态也是保障稳定运行的重要措施。 为了提高整体性能,可以考虑使用缓存技术,如OPcache来加速PHP执行,或者使用Redis、Memcached来减轻数据库压力。这些工具的合理配置能够有效减少响应时间,提升用户体验。 安全设置不容忽视。限制PHP脚本的执行权限、关闭不必要的功能、设置合理的文件访问控制,都是防止潜在攻击的有效手段。同时,保持系统和软件的及时更新,能有效防范已知漏洞。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

